Hi,

A friend of mine got a KBD67 r2 lite bluetooth variant (YD67BLE VER 1.1 PCB), and we've been trying to configure the board with via or qmk configurator but it won't get detected, did a bit of research and found that this board stock isn't qmk compatible, so I was wondering if there is any workaround for that so we can use VIA. (know there's ydkb but VIA is kinda fancier and more useful in some aspects)

Bit late replay, but I hope is worth posting:

The latest firmware for YD67BLE PCB used in KBD67 Lite BT works with VIA. You'll need to connect it by USB and load .json file into VIA (download from KBD67Llite page - section "Wireless PCB specs").

To flash the very latest firmware you need to download it from the ZMK configurator page (you can skip actual configuring, just select YD67BLE and click download at the top right). For how to flash it see the manual.

In any case I recommend learning useful built-in shortcuts on ZMK configurator (section "LEDs & Functions") e.g. "Lock Mode" and "Output battery level".

Personally I found few combined key functions better on ZMK i.e. default Esc that can do Alt+F4 if pressed with Alt (not found on QMK), also setting double functions (e.g. hold for layer/mod key, tap for single key) is quite easier by drop down menus under the keyboard map window ("Choose Action" section shown after you select a key you want to modify) - I got my CapsLock key configured as Fn key when held and Caps when tapped.

If you not going to be constantly remapping your keyboard with VIA why not just use ZMK configurator?
